NEWS
Ryepress has now opened in the centre of Hastings old town! Situated in the well known Retro shop in Hastings High street this new Print studio and Gallery joins a growing collection of galleries in what is fast becoming East Sussex’s newest centre for the Arts.
With the eponymous Rye press now installed, the studio will soon be featuring periodic etching demonstrations, with a unique opportunity to see the process in action and buy Colin Bailey's limited edition prints of Hastings, Rye and the East Sussex coast straight from the press.
The etching studio will be holding printing demonstrations throughout the summer. Please watch this space for details.
